Ozone system equipment refers to a series of professional equipment used to generate, control and apply ozone. Ozone (O3) is a highly oxidizing gas, which has a wide range of applications in many industrial and environmental fields, such as water treatment, air purification, food processing and medical disinfection.
Ozone system equipment usually includes the following main parts:
1. Ozone generator: This is the core part of the system, used to convert oxygen (O2) into ozone. The ozone generator includes a high voltage electrode and a ground electrode, and generates a corona discharge by applying a high voltage between the electrodes, thereby converting oxygen into ozone.
2. Air supply device: usually includes air compressor, air purifier and oxygen concentrator, etc., used to provide pure oxygen required for ozone generation.
3. Ozone detection and control system: used to monitor and adjust the concentration and output of ozone. This may include ozone sensors, concentration controllers, and associated electronic control systems.
4. Safety equipment: including valves, pressure relief devices, alarm systems, etc., to ensure that the ozone supply can be cut off in time when abnormal conditions occur and to ensure the safety of personnel and equipment.
Exhaust gas treatment device: Since the ozone will remain after completing its treatment task, this part of the exhaust gas needs to be treated by a specific device to prevent adverse effects on the environment.
Factors to consider when selecting ozone system equipment include the specific needs of the application, processing scale, reliability and safety of the equipment, ease of operation, maintenance costs, and after-sales service. In addition, because ozone has certain potential risks to human health and the environment, relevant safety regulations and environmental protection requirements must be strictly observed when using ozone system equipment.
